Domestic dispute ends in husband's death
Andrea Natekar, Tribune
A domestic fight in Mesa ended in a man's death late Thursday night when he was thrown from the hood of a car.
Police said the incident began earlier in the night when the man, whose name was not released, went to a party where he was confronted by his wife. The couple fought before his wife left with her cousin, and the husband followed them in a pickup truck.
The vehicles pulled over near University Drive and 22nd Street, and the husband rammed the back of the car, got out and started beating on the car's windows and jumping on the hood, police said.
As he was still on the hood, the cousin began to drive the car away, and the man was thrown onto the road, police said.
"We're not sure at this point if he was killed from the impact of being thrown or if he was run over by the car," said Mesa police Detective Steve Berry.
The man was pronounced dead at the scene.
Police said the driver of the car fled the scene, although he later turned himself in. He was arrested on suspicion of hit-and-run.
